Overview of the Technical Issue Reporting Process

Reporting technical issues promptly is essential to maintaining an efficient and functional My Ford Benefits Employee Login Portal. By reporting problems, employees enable the Ford technical support team to investigate and resolve issues effectively. Here is a step-by-step guide on how to report technical issues with the portal:

  1. Document the issue: Before contacting technical support, note down the details of the problem you encountered, such as error messages received, specific actions taken, or any other relevant information.
  2. Visit the support website: Ford provides an official support website specifically designed for addressing technical issues related to the benefits portal. Access this website using any web browser and search for the technical issue reporting section.
  3. Choose a reporting method: Once on the support website, you will find various channels to report technical issues. These channels typically include web forms, email addresses, and helpline numbers. Select the most appropriate method based on the urgency and complexity of the problem.
  4. Provide necessary details: To assist the technical support team in understanding the issue, provide accurate and detailed information. Include specifics such as the date and time of the problem, the device and browser you are using, and any error codes or error messages received.
  5. Follow up if necessary: After reporting the issue, it is essential to keep track of the progress. Frequently check your email for updates and provide any additional information requested by the technical support team, if required.

Detailed Troubleshooting Tips for Users

To assist users in resolving common technical issues on their own, here are some troubleshooting tips:

  1. Clear browser cache and cookies: Accumulated cache and cookies can sometimes interfere with portal functionality. Clearing browser cache and cookies may resolve login, loading, or display issues.
  2. Check internet connectivity: Ensure that you have stable internet connectivity. Verify if other websites or applications are experiencing connectivity issues. If necessary, switch to a different network or contact your internet service provider.
  3. Verify login credentials: Double-check login credentials and ensure that passwords are entered correctly. Use the password reset functionality if needed.
  4. Try a different browser: If you experience problems with a specific browser, try logging in using an alternative browser. This can help identify if the issue is specific to the browser you are using.

If the above troubleshooting steps do not resolve the issue or if the problem persists, it is strongly recommended to contact Ford technical support for further assistance.
